P.L. 2022, CHAPTER 124, approved December 1, 2022

Assembly, No. 3991, (First Reprint)

 

 


An Act concerning the regulation of honey.

 

     Be It Enacted by the Senate and General Assembly of the State of New Jersey:

 

     1.    1[a.]1  For the purposes of N.J.A.C.8:24-1.5 et seq. or any other applicable rule or regulation, honey that is raw and has not been processed, infused, pasteurized, or otherwise modified or combined with any other food or product shall not be deemed to be a "cottage food product," as defined in N.J.A.C.8:24-1.5.

     1[b.  Within 60 days after the effective date of this section, the Department of Agriculture and the Department of Health shall adopt or amend rules or regulations as may be necessary to effectuate the purposes of this section.  The rules and regulations shall become effective immediately upon the filing of proper notice with the Office of Administrative Law, shall remain in effect for a period not to exceed 18 months after the date of filing, and, thereafter, shall be adopted, amended, or readopted in accordance with the "Administrative Procedure Act," P.L.1968, c.410 (C.52:14B-1 et seq.).]1

 

     2.    This act shall take effect immediately.
